What Are White-Collar Crimes?

White-collar crimes generally involve non-violent offenses that are intricately connected to financial or business activities. These cases often arise from serious allegations such as fraud, embezzlement, financial misrepresentation, or other conduct that involves the manipulation of money or property for personal gain. In many of these situations, the accusations involve individuals who held positions of trust or responsibility within a business, organization, or professional role, making the breach of that trust even more consequential.


Although these offenses do not involve physical violence, they are taken very seriously by prosecutors and investigators alike, as they can have far-reaching effects on victims and the economy as a whole. White-collar cases can involve extensive financial records, complex transactions, and detailed investigations that require a high level of knowledge to navigate effectively.
